Latest Patents

Matsubara holds a patent for an "Eyeglasses lens measurement device and non-transitory computer-readable storage medium." This device is designed to measure the eyeglasses lens of eyeglasses. It includes a light source that emits a measurement light flux toward the eyeglasses lens, a transmissive display that transmits the measurement light flux and displays an index pattern formed by a plurality of indexes, a detector that detects the measurement light flux passing through the eyeglasses lens and the transmissive display, and a controller. The controller is responsible for controlling the display of the index pattern, acquiring an optical characteristic of the eyeglasses lens based on the detection result of the detector, and obtaining lens information that differs from the optical characteristic of the eyeglasses lens.
